An EL display device capable of producing a vivid multi-gradation color
display, and an electronic device having the EL display device. An
electric current supplied to an EL element 110 is controlled by providing
a resistor 109 between a current control TFT 108 and the EL element 110
formed in a pixel 104, the resistor 109 having a resistance higher than
the on-resistance of the current control TFT 108. The gradation display
is executed by a time-division drive system which controls the emission
and non-emission of light of the EL element 110 by time, preventing the
effect caused by a dispersion in the characteristics of the current
control TFT 108.
